About

The Master of Philosophy (MPhil) in Advanced Chemical Engineering at the University of Cambridge is a highly specialized program designed for students seeking to deepen their knowledge of chemical engineering principles and applications. This 11-month full-time program focuses on advanced topics such as process engineering, biochemical engineering, and sustainable chemical processes. Students will engage with cutting-edge research and gain hands-on experience in solving complex engineering problems that address global challenges in energy, environment, and materials science.

Throughout the program, students will have the opportunity to conduct research under the guidance of world-class faculty, utilizing state-of-the-art laboratories and research facilities. The program combines theoretical knowledge with practical application, preparing graduates to make significant contributions to industries such as pharmaceuticals, biotechnology, energy production, and environmental engineering.

Program Structure

The MPhil in Advanced Chemical Engineering is an 11-month full-time program that combines academic coursework and independent research. Students will take part in lectures, seminars, and research projects focused on advanced chemical engineering topics. Key subjects include reaction engineering, process systems engineering, and biochemical processes. The program’s research component allows students to conduct original research in cutting-edge areas of chemical engineering, contributing to the development of innovative solutions in industries such as energy, pharmaceuticals, and materials science. Students will also have access to Cambridge’s world-class laboratories and research centers.

Career Opportunities

Graduates of the MPhil in Advanced Chemical Engineering program will be well-equipped for leadership roles in the chemical engineering and biotechnology sectors. Career opportunities exist in industries such as pharmaceuticals, energy, environmental management, and advanced materials. Graduates can pursue roles as process engineers, research scientists, and project managers in global engineering firms, research institutes, or government agencies. Many students also choose to continue their academic careers by pursuing a PhD in chemical engineering or a related field.
